Understanding Title Review and Insurance

What is a title review? It verifies ownership history and checks for liens, judgments, and defects that could affect transfer.

What is title insurance? It is a policy that protects you from losses due to title defects not found during review, helping you close with confidence.

Definition and Explanation

Title review is a due diligence step in real estate transactions. Title insurance provides ongoing protection against past problems that surface after closing.

Key Elements and Processes

Key elements include chain of title verification, public records review, lien clearance, and policy scope. The process typically involves preliminary title search, document collection, and coordination with lenders.

Key Terms and Glossary

Glossary terms related to title and insurance help buyers and sellers understand protections and responsibilities.

TITLE

A legal document showing ownership and the right to transfer property.

LIEN

A legal claim against property, often for unpaid debts, that can affect transfer.

ENCUMBRANCE

A claim or burden on a property that may limit transfer or value.

TITLE INSURANCE

A policy that protects against losses from title defects not found in the initial search.

Legal Process Step 1

Initial title search and document gathering to establish a baseline.

Review Chain of Title

We verify ownership history and identify gaps or defects.

Assess Preliminary Title Report

We analyze the preliminary report and flag issues for resolution.

Legal Process Step 2

Resolve title defects and coordinate with lenders.

Curative Actions

Pursue deeds, releases, or quiet title actions as needed.

Review Title Insurance Options

Explain policy choices and coverage to fit your transaction.

Legal Process Step 3

Finalize and issue the title policy at closing.

Policy Issuance

Delivery of the policy and endorsements.

Post-Closing Support

Assistance with future title questions or claims.
